What is the fuel tank capacity of the Boyue in liters?

Boyue fuel tank capacity is 58 liters, which is the officially announced data. The Boyue uses 92-octane gasoline, with a fuel consumption of 7.1 to 7.7L per 100 kilometers. A full tank can cover a distance of 753 to 817km. During daily driving, it is necessary to always pay attention to the remaining fuel level in the tank. This is usually observed through the fuel gauge inside the vehicle. If there are no other issues, the fuel level will be accurately reflected on the gauge. The fuel gauge typically has 5 to 6 segments, and it is advisable to refuel when there are about 2 segments left to avoid running out of fuel midway. During the actual refueling process, the amount of fuel may exceed the marked capacity. This is because the fuel tank capacity marked by the car manufacturer is from the bottom of the tank to the safe limit, and there is still some space from the safe limit to the tank opening. This space is reserved to ensure that the fuel inside the tank can expand when the temperature rises without overflowing. If fuel is added up to the tank opening during refueling, the actual refueling amount may exceed the marked tank capacity.

What is Included in the Vehicle Environmental Protection List?

It includes the manufacturer's declaration that the vehicle meets emission standards and stages, basic vehicle information, environmental inspection information, and key environmental configuration details. Below are the relevant details: 1. Basic vehicle information: Model name, trademark, vehicle type, identification method and location for N3 models, vehicle manufacturer name, production plant address. 2. Basic engine information: Engine model, engine family name, brand, engine type, manufacturer name, production plant address, engine serial number. 3. Inspection information and model parameters: Configuration extension number, inspection report number, inspection agency name, factory inspection results, key environmental configurations.

What are the consequences of low tire pressure?

Low tire pressure can increase tire body deformation, leading to cracks on the tire sidewalls, excessive heat generation, accelerated rubber aging, increased tire contact area with the ground, and faster wear on the tire shoulders. Below is relevant information about car tires: 1. Functions of tires: Support the entire weight of the vehicle, bear the load of the car, and transmit forces and moments in other directions; transfer traction and braking torque, ensuring good adhesion between the wheels and the road surface to improve the car's power performance, braking performance, and passability; work together with the car suspension to cushion the impact during driving. 2. Tire lifespan: The lifespan of a tire is related to many factors, such as climate, road conditions, driving habits, installation, maintenance, etc. According to international regulations, if the tire is used normally, it must be replaced when the tread depth wears down to 1.6 millimeters.

What does additional practice for Subject 3 mean?

Additional practice for Subject 3 refers to extra driving practice sessions outside the regular driving school curriculum. Below are the relevant details: 1. Subject 3: This includes the road driving skills test and the safety and civilized driving knowledge test, which are part of the motor vehicle driver's license examination. It is the abbreviation for the road driving skills and safety and civilized driving knowledge test in the motor vehicle driver's examination. The content of the road driving skills test varies depending on the type of vehicle being licensed. 2. Test content: Preparation before driving, simulated lighting test, starting, driving in a straight line, shifting gears, changing lanes, pulling over, going straight through intersections, turning left at intersections, turning right at intersections, crossing pedestrian crossings, passing school zones, passing bus stops, meeting oncoming vehicles, overtaking, making U-turns, and nighttime driving. The safety and civilized driving knowledge test generally includes: requirements for safe and civilized driving operations, safe driving knowledge under adverse weather and complex road conditions, emergency handling methods for situations like tire blowouts, and post-accident handling knowledge.

Can a Car Dashboard Turned White After Wiping with Alcohol Be Repaired?

The surface has been completely damaged and cannot be repaired; it can only be replaced. Below is relevant information about car dashboards: 1. Car Dashboard: A car dashboard is a device that reflects the working conditions of various vehicle systems. Common gauges on a car dashboard include the speedometer, tachometer, oil pressure gauge, fuel gauge, water temperature gauge, and charging gauge. 2. Indicator Lights: These include the coolant level warning light, fuel level indicator, washer fluid level indicator, charging indicator, high/low beam indicator, transmission gear indicator, anti-lock braking system (ABS) indicator, traction control indicator, and airbag warning light.
